The Council known as the Blacktown City, or an accredited certifier, can approve your secondary dwelling under Complying Development (CDC), as long as it meets the specific benchmarks as set in the State Environmental Planning Policy (Affordable Rental Housing) 2009 (AHSEPP). Under the new medium-density housing code announced last week, duplexes, terraces and manor houses can be approved as complying developments in as little as 20 days, skipping the development application process. Under the new code, blocks must be either 400 square metres or the minimum lot size required by council, whichever is greater. The consequence of this is that cl 4.1AC of the Precinct Plan operates as a development standard which, unless displaced as discussed below, acts as a barrier to approving the Companys development proposal for the site. If lodging the same DA in another precinct under the Growth Centres SEPP, you will need to check whether the minimum lot size requirement is similar and whether a clause 4.6 is required. That is, there is a preference to interpret the Affordable Housing SEPP and Growth Centres SEPP in a consistent way. The minimum lot size requirement still applies, and so a clause 4.6 variation request must be submitted with the application to enable Council to grant consent. Justice Moore accepted that there was a conflict between the two clauses and stated (with emphasis added): Whilst it is correct that the Growth Centres SEPP is an earlier environmental planning instrument than the Affordable Rental Housing SEPP, that simplistic proposition does not have regard to the fact that the specific provision imposing the limitation in cl 4.1AC of the Precinct Plan was inserted by an amendment to the Growth Centres SEPP, made some nearly five years after the coming into effect of the Affordable Rental Housing SEPP. All fees can be seen in the Blacktown City Councils Goods and Services Pricing which you can search for online. In this context, a proper understanding of timing makes it clear that the Precinct Plan provision is to be regarded as reflecting a later drafting intention than that of the earlier Affordable Rental Housing SEPP provision.
